Web Services: A Comparison of Soap and Rest Services

Festim Halili, Erenis Ramadani


The interest on Web services has been growing rapidly in these couple of years since their start of use. A web service would be described as a method for exchanging/communicating information between devices over a network. Often, when deciding which service would fit on the architecture design to develop a product, then the question rises which service to use and when?

SOAP (Simple Object Access Protocol) and REST (Representational State Transfer) are the two most used protocols to exchange messages, so choosing one over the other has its own advantages and disadvantages. In this paper we have addressed the differences and best practices when to use one over the other.

Full Text:


DOI: https://doi.org/10.5539/mas.v12n3p175

Copyright (c) 2018 Erenis Ramadani, Festim Halili

License URL: http://creativecommons.org/licenses/by/4.0

Modern Applied Science   ISSN 1913-1844 (Print)   ISSN 1913-1852 (Online)  Email: mas@ccsenet.org

Copyright © Canadian Center of Science and Education

To make sure that you can receive messages from us, please add the 'ccsenet.org' domain to your e-mail 'safe list'. If you do not receive e-mail in your 'inbox', check your 'bulk mail' or 'junk mail' folders.